perlxs.pod: remove section on %v
The XS parser supported an extremely obscure bit of functionality which
made use of the %v package variable to maintain state between different
bits of typemap processing. This was accidentally broken in 5.10.0:
refactoring removed the 'use vars "%v"' line, and no one seemed to
notice or care.
Also, the sole example of its use in the docs seemed to be obscure,
confusing and probably wrong.
There was a consensus in the discussion at
http://nntp.perl.org/group/perl.perl5.porters/267667
that we should stop documenting this feature rather than trying to fix
it.

perlxs.pod: delete most non-ref sections
This commit is a simple cut which deletes several '=head2' sections from
perlxs.pod. The next commit will tidy up and fix any broken links etc.
These sections are more tutorial-like, and aren't in line with the goal
of this branch that perlxs.pod becomes purely a reference manual for XS.
Any relevant information from these sections may be incorporated later
into new sections in perlxs.pod and/or be included in a future rewrite
of perlxstut.pod.

perlxs.pod: add a new introductory part
Four commits ago, I removed most of the general text sections in
perlxs (i.e. the ones not specifically about a particular keyword).
Now this commit adds a completely new introductory part to perlxs, about
1200 lines long. It represents an attempt to write a background to what
XS and XSUBs, SVs, typemaps etc are, in a complete and modern way.
The existing reference section for each keyword follows it.
I tried to avoid getting too tutorial-like (that's what perlxstut is
for), but I may have crossed the line in various places. In particular
it has a new section which could have been titled "all the bits of
perlguts you need to know in order to write non-trivial XSUBs without
having to actually read perlguts".

perlxs.pod: standardise version numbers in the doc
After the big rewrite, various bits of text which describe when a
particular feature was introduced or changed have ended up using a
random mixture of Perl, ParseXS and xsubpp version numbers.
This commit standardises on xsubpp version numbers. These are mostly
the same as ParseXS, but this handles the cases before ParseXS was
split off from xsubpp. Perl versions suffer from not exactly matching
when an xsubpp version number was incremented, and not matching what is
used by the "REQUIRE:" keyword.
This commit also adds a short new section which tries to explain how the
three sets of version numbers are related.
